Dharaimafi

Dharaimafi is a village located in Amethi tehsil of Sultan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Amethi (tehsildar office) and 28km away from district headquarter Sultanpur. As per 2009 stats, Dharaimafi village is also a gram panchayat.

About Dharaimafi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dharaimafi is 169442. The village spans a total geographical area of 131.79 hectares. Amethij is nearest town to Dharaimafi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Dharaimafi

According to the 2011 Census, Dharaimafi has a total population of about 1,445, with approximately 749 males and 696 females. The sex ratio is around 929 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 169 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 197 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 63.46%, with male literacy at about 71.83% and female literacy near 54.45%. There are around 234 households in the village. Connectivity of Dharaimafi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dharaimafi. As per the 2011 stats, Dharaimafi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
